Paper Flowers with Straw Stems

Looking for a fresh twist on paper crafting? Say hello to paper flowers with a sip of fun—these charming blooms come with straw stems! 🌸🥤

Whether you’re raiding your scrap bin or showing off your favorite patterned paper, this project is a playful way to mix creativity with gratitude.

Paper Flowers with Straw Stems How-to:

1.Create the Flower Petals and Leaves:

-Die-cut or punch 8 petals using oval or circle shapes out of various designs of paper

-Die-cut or punch 2-4 leaves using oval or circle shapes out of various designs of paper

-Punch a small hole on one end of each of the pieces.  I used a 1/4″ hole punch.

-Die-cut or punch 2 -1 1/4″ circles , one for the top of the flower and one for the bottom of the petals.  Punch a small hole in the center of each circle.

2.Assemble the Flowers

-Thread one of the punched circles into a straw

-Add a touch of liquid glue to the top of the circle

-Thread one of the petals into the top of the straw, securing it to the circle.

-Continue adding petals and leaves, securing each with a small amount of liquid glue.

-Add a touch of liquid glue to the bottom of the second punched circle.  Thread into the top of the straw, securing it to the top petals.

3.Complete the Flowers

-Tie a piece of ribbon around the straw stem

-Stamp greeting on a piece of coordinating card stock

-Punch using a 1″ circle punch

-Punch a small hole in the top of the greeting and thread a piece of linen thread or baker’s twine

-Tie the greeting to the ribbon on the straw stem

 

 

-For the topper, I cut and folded a strip of coordinating card stock.  Then I cut it with a pair of multi-bladed scissors and rolled it into a tight circle, leaving an opening to thread into the top of the straw, securing it with a bit of liquid glue.
